DBS Foundation Awards Grants to 9 Social Enterprises Across Asia

DBS Foundation, a Singaporeean NGO dedicated to championing social entrepreneurship, has awarded around Rs 6.79 Cr) to nine social enterprises (SEs) as part of its 2019 DBS Foundation Social Enterprise Grant Programme.

This year, the DBS Foundation Social Enterprise Grant Programme received a record 600 applications from social enterprises across Asia.

The 2019 DBS Foundation Social Enterprise Grant Programme awardees include S4S Technologies from India, a food tech company serving the global dehydrated food market with its patented UN-award winning solar dehydration technology.

The grant funding will also support this year's awardees from India, Singapore, China, Hong Kong, Indonesia and Taiwan to deploy social innovations in areas such as healthcare, nutrition, employability and income generation, education, energy, environment protection and waste management.
